The showline/display line is blue in the picture, basically over the main runway. This is for most of the performers.Airbourne wrote:Yes, I always knew where El Centro's Flight paths were, but I mean the definition of "Display Line" and "Flight Line."Scarecrow wrote:Does this help?
For anyone wanting to add a second demonstration and wants it to be military, please do so. (Just fill out the form).
We were just limiting it to one military and one aerobatic display per person but not to many were signing up for aerobatic performances, so we are letting a second military demonstration. Still keeping it at 2 per person, though.
The lighter "old" runway (that has "U.S. NAVY" on it) is the flightline/ramp where the aircraft will be parked. This will also be used as a showline for smaller aircraft (propeller driven, etc.) for aerobatic routines - OR - high speed level passes by the jets.
